This cache is dedicated to all of the students, past, present and future who participate in the Adventures in Peacemaking and Diversity program, (APD). APD is a year long adventure program shaping the culture of entire school communities. Participating schools in Bristol and Plymouth join with the Bristol Youth Service staff and the Pine Lake Challenge Course staff to encourage students to embrace a multi-cultural society and to encourage them to explore their world. Each year over 300, 3rd to 5th graders unite with their pen pals from an urban or suburban school to work together on hands-on/ minds-on activities in science, math and language arts at their schools and at the Pine Lake Challenge Course. Geocaching has been part of that math and science curriculum. The APD students love geocaching. So this is their cache.
